titleOfInvention Far-infrared emitter
abstract An object of the present invention is to provide a far-infrared emitter that can generate far-infrared rays more efficiently. SOLUTION: The surface of a pulverized granule or plate-like material of natural ore is supported by a fine particle of far-infrared emitting material made of natural ore or metal oxide having a far-infrared emissivity of 85% or more. Far-infrared emitters, natural ore cut into a plate shape, the far-infrared emitting substance fine powder was carried on the surface, or crushed, chamfered to round the pulverized product, The surface carries far-infrared emitting substance fine powder and does not hurt the body when used as a stone bath.
